April 15, 2023 - First bottle from a case bought a few years back following Neal Martin’s raving review. Pale yellow, pronounced acidity but well integrated, precise, feels like 3g dosage but actually it’s 8g so this must be seriously lean to start with. Well done in that sense as the wine feels very cohesive.
While this is pleasant to drink if you like your wines more on the lean side, I am not getting much depth or excitement here, but then I strongly prefer BdN over BdB in general. Drink at your leisure over the next 10 years.

June 3, 2022 - Premium wine £85. All estate fruit. 8g RS.
Super lemony nose, lemon meringue pie.
Firm acidity, there's a coiled power here, intense followed by a lovely meaty smoky marmite quality.
Quite challenging but also very impressive. I bet this will age superbly.
